# Env Vars: Planner Regression Mitigation

After the query planner regression in Corvid DB 9.3, Fernwell's release builds must pin the legacy planner until the patched build ships. Set `CORVID_PLANNER_MODE=legacy` in the release env file and confirm it with the preflight check before tagging. The planner override endpoint requires authentication, so the release env file also needs the planner override token on the next line.

env line for kahof-fajeg: ARCHIVE_KEY3=397

**Vendor note: Inkmill markdown pipeline**

Rendering for Parchway docs is outsourced to Inkmill under an annual contract, renewing each March. They handle sanitization and PDF export; we own the upload queue. SLA: 4-hour response on rendering failures. Escalate only after two failed retries. Their support desk is reachable at the address below.

billing contact of hahaf-baguf = zorael.tammir.jorius@sivrelhq.internal

# Brindlekit Environments: Hermetic Build Migration

The Brindlekit build has moved to a hermetic build system. Plugin builds no longer read from the host toolchain; all compilers, SDKs, and pinned dependencies come from the managed cache. If your plugin shelled out to system tools, declare them as build inputs instead. Sandboxed builds are enforced in CI and optional locally for now. Each environment's build behavior is governed by the values below.

deployment values, faduf-tawep:
SORDOR_LOG_LEVEL=error
SORDOR_METRICS_HOST=metrics.sordor.nelvrolabs.internal
SORDOR_POOL_SIZE=4